Exploring Your Rights in a Contested Divorce: South African Law
Embarking on a court-ordered separation can be an emotionally arduous experience. In South Africa, the legal structure governing divorce cases is designed to ensure fairness and protect the rights of all parties involved, particularly in contested divorces where spouses diverge on key matters. It's crucial for individuals navigating this intricate process to comprehend their legal position and the available remedies.
- A contested divorce typically involves arguments regarding issues such as child custody, spousal alimony, division of property, and more. In these situations, the court plays a key role in settling these disagreements based on applicable laws and evidence.
- South African law emphasizes the best interests of children when making decisions related to custody and visitation. Judges consider a range of factors, including the child's age, emotional needs, and the parents' ability to provide a stable and nurturing setting.
- It is highly advised that individuals involved in a contested divorce consult an attorney. An experienced family lawyer can assist you through the legal process, protect your rights, and advocate for your interests effectively in court.
Understanding your rights within the South African legal framework is paramount when navigating a contested divorce. By obtaining proper legal guidance, you can improve your chances of achieving a fair and equitable outcome that satisfies your needs and those of your family.
Finding the Suitable Divorce Lawyer for Your Situation
Navigating a divorce can be incredibly stressful and overwhelming. It's crucial to have an experienced and knowledgeable legal advocate by your side to guide you through the complex process and protect your interests. When choosing a divorce attorney, consider these aspects:
* **Experience:** Look for an attorney with a proven track record of successfully handling divorce cases, especially those similar to yours.
* **Specialization:** Some attorneys specialize in specific areas of family law, such as high-net-worth divorces or child custody disputes. If your case involves complex issues, it's beneficial to find an attorney with relevant expertise.
* **Communication Style:** Effective communication is key. Choose an attorney who is responsive, accessible, and clearly explains legal concepts in a way you understand.
* **Personality Fit:** You'll be working closely with your attorney, so it's important to feel at ease with their personality and approach. Schedule consultations with several attorneys to find someone who is a good fit for you.
